提供商如何測試支付誠信
插槽付款的誠信取決於三個支柱:正確的RNG,符合聲明的RTP的實際回報以及透明的遙測。下面是對提供者和獨立實驗室如何驗證每個級別的實際分析:從數學和模擬到發布後監控。
1)「支付誠實」意味著什麼"
RNG是正確的:隨機數序列是獨立且不可預測的,時期和分布符合標準。
RTP對應於聲明的自旋數量眾多,平均後坐力趨向於具有預期分布的數學嵌入值。
波動性得到證實:收益分配形式(小型/稀有大型)與模型沒有差異。
邏輯是一致的:每個費率和結果都是固定的,可以復制/審核。
更改是可控的:任何更新都不會隱蔽地影響賠率,並經過重新驗證。
2)RNG測試: 從理論到實踐
2.1.RNG體系結構
服務器端RNG(優先)或帶有防拭子的安全客戶端。
RNG與業務邏輯的分離;控制二進制和configs的完整性。
2.2.算法驗證
驗證生成器屬性(周期、均勻性、無相關性)。
正確初始化坐標(熵源,重復保護,鍵/非鍵)。
2.3.統計測試包
頻率/分布集(類別的χ ²,連續的Kolmogorov-Smirnov)。
序列測試(運行測試,串行校正)。
碰撞/周期區塊測試,分為窗口。
對於密碼學RNG,還有額外的節拍測試(單調性,隨機步行)。
2.4.可回收運行
種子固定→測試環境中序列的可重復性。
與RNG參考實現,庫版本控制的比較。
3)數學驗證: RTP,方差和分布形式
3.1.理論模型
完整描述支付表、字符掉落概率、獎金規則、觸發概率、頭獎。
預期回報計算(RTP)和數學方差/可變性指數。
3.2.蒙特卡洛模擬
10^8到10^9+帶有度量固定功能的自旋運行:- 平均RTP及其置信區間;
- 按大小分配獎金(贏樂隊);
- 獎金/重觸發器的頻率;
- 「幹」和獲勝條紋的長度。
3.3.比較理論vs模擬
關鍵指標的公差是預先規定的(例如RTP ± N旋轉時為0.1 p.p.)。
無法通過任何KPI →原因分析(字符權重,級聯邊界,舍入錯誤)。
3.4.檢查頭獎
單獨的積累/衰減模擬:- 扣除額的正確性(貢獻);
- 獲勝時頭獎級別的分配;
- 門口沒有「城堡」。
4)影響誠實感知的功能和UX測試
幫助和規則:付款表,獎金描述,示例-沒有隱藏的條件。
概率顯示:在哪裏odds/RTP格式需要清晰的表述。
UI不變量:動畫/效果不會產生錯誤的「加熱」插槽信號。
本地化:沒有模棱兩可的翻譯,正確的警告和年齡標記。
5)徽標和遙測: 如何證明誠實
5.1.強制性事件
利率,結果,資產負債表變化;獎金觸發器;限制/超時更改;技術問題。
精確的超時(UTC),會話標識符和賬單版本,配置哈希。
5.2.不變性和出口
期刊寫成受保護的倉庫(WORM/轉化);- 審計員/操作員的標準化上載;
客戶端和服務器日誌的相關性。
5.3.繼電器機械師
能夠通過seed/nonce和機制版本復制特定的旋轉。
內部「黑匣子」:在幾秒鐘內診斷有爭議的案件。
6)發布之前: 錯誤的「紅色區域」以及如何捕獲它們
1.符號/權重頻率與GDD不匹配。鼓/節拍電路→自動鏡頭。
2.乘數四舍五入/誤差。→邊界上的付費函數的統一測試。
3.獎金/級聯中的錯誤狀態。→ State-fuzzing,通過「不可能」分支的代理。
4.市場構建中的錯誤。→差異矩陣(語言/限制/圖標),configs自動反駁。
5.通過編譯器/庫對RNG進行隨機更改。→可重復的構建,粘貼版本,哈希控制。
7)發布後: 持續誠實監控
7.1.RTP guardrails
通過窗口對實際RTP進行在線計算(例如,最後的10-5000萬自旋)。
信號:超出置信區間,獎金頻率漂移,異常流。
7.2.波動性驗證
將經驗方差與設計進行比較;
熱卡「獲勝大小×頻率」。
7.3.反血汗工廠和exploata
投註模式異常、協調腳本、可疑客戶/插件。
頭獎保護:關卡邊界上的「farming」細節。
7.4.事件和回滾
熱修復法規(不改變數學);- 如果機械師/賠率受到影響,則重新認證;
向運營商報告,並在需要時向監管機構報告。
8)提供商如何記錄誠實
RNG檔案:算法,初始化,分布,熵源。
模擬報告:技術,種子,自旋量,RTP/波動性總和,圖表。
更改日誌:法案版本、哈希版本、更改的內容以及原因。
RG和IB政策:可用性,備份,事件,DPIA/隱私。
市場建築物驗證登記冊:每個國家的區別和參照證書/報告。
9)頭獎和網絡池: 特殊檢查
財務誠信:繳款額與報告一致。
池同步:nods/運算符之間的共識,對通信中斷的抵抗力。
玩家參考:池如何生長,如何支付,級別和賠率。
獲勝力:付款時的詳細交易/事件日誌。
10)獨立實驗室的作用
檢查RNG、數學、功能、日誌、RG和市場需求。
發布符合特定司法管轄區標準的報告/證書。
在升級時進行倒退:任何可能影響賠率/規則界面的事情-重新測試。
11)典型的玩家誤解(以及如何通過檢查來回應)
「遊戲適應玩家」。→ RNG和付款不知道「誰在玩」;個性化與界面/學習有關,沒有機會。
「在輸掉系列賽的晚上/之後,機會更高。」→後果是獨立的;流是分散的自然部分。
「區域/設備更改RTP」。→僅允許批準的市場版本;任何差異-在幫助和證書中。
12)供應商支票單
將遊戲發送到實驗室之前
- GDD/數學一致,RTP/波動性計算已記錄在案。
- 自旋≥10^8模擬,置信間隔報告。
- RNG檔案和測試協議完整;描述了種子管理。
- Logi:事件列表、格式、導出;沿著種子的倒帶。
- 參考/本地化/標簽減去,市場驗證。
- Repeatable build、hashi、pinning依賴項。
發布後
- 帶有差分閾值的RTP/波動性和獎金頻率差。
- 事件/hotfix計劃,重新認證標準。
- 定期對頭獎/操作員桌面進行報告對賬。
- 合作夥伴的季度日誌審核和賬單版本控制。
13)典型的錯誤以及如何避免它們
1.置信區間未計入。-計劃模擬的數量,以便RTP的CI已經是所需的公差。
2.由於初始化不正確,RNG中的隱藏依賴關系。-按事件分隔seed/nonce,避免重播。
3.圖形的變化影響了數學。-UI不得影響付費功能;單位測試「關鍵路徑」。
4.弱日誌。-標準化電路,存儲UTC,消除手動編輯,實施後繼。
5.Market build是「手動」組裝的。-自動裝配和驗證差異;維護哈希註冊表。
14)短質量路線圖(90天)
0-30天:RNG/數學審計,可重復構建的實施,對日誌和反射進行標準化。
31-60天:大規模模擬、指標/公差固定、報告準備;市場反駁。
61-90天:與RGS/操作員進行集成測試,試點發布,RTP/波動性監控儀表板,事件過程調試。
支付誠信測試是一個系統而不是一次性行為:正確的RNG,嚴格的模擬數學,透明的邏輯和變化的學科。將誠信設計為體系結構一部分的提供商(繼電器,可重復的組件,RTP監視)通過實驗室的速度更快,不太可能捕獲事件,並獲得最重要的是玩家和合作夥伴的信任。